Pittosporum tobira, renowned for its lustrous evergreen leaves and delightful honey-scented flowers, makes an exceptional addition to any garden. This medium shrub grows slowly into a rounded form, adorned with glossy, leathery leaves arranged in whorls. During late spring and early summer, it produces large umbels of small, fragrant flowers that transition from white to yellow, creating a beautiful display.Ideal for sheltered courtyards or coastal gardens, Pittosporum tobira can be grown outside in mild areas or kept in a large patio container and moved to a frost-free location. It?s a versatile plant that can be used as a foundation shrub, hedging, or container specimen. Its robust nature and ornamental appeal have earned it an RHS Award of Garden Merit.How to Grow Instructions: Light: Thrives in sun or shade; sunny positions encourage more flowering.
